用直觉模糊Petri网构建的供应链可靠性诊断模型
Reliability diagnosis model of supply chain based on intuitionistic fuzzy Petri net
摘要
Abstract
In view of the continuous changes of internal and external environment factors of supply chain system, the reli-ability of the supply chain system is built, the intuitionistic fuzzy set is introduced into the fuzzy Petri net model, and the model of supply chain reliability based on intuitionistic fuzzy Petri net is constructed by using intuitionistic fuzzy num-bers. On the base of the change and the relationship between the kinds of fuzzy inference rules, the fuzzy inference rules of the supply chain reliability diagnosis model are divided into four types, which are obtained by the changes of the fuzzy inference rules with prior or after trigger. At the same time, the fuzzy reasoning algorithm is put forward, and the validity of the model and the algorithm is verified by an example.关键词
